Abstract

The invention discloses a tongue movement mechanism of a humanoid head robot. The tongue movement mechanism comprises a tongue tip special-shaped block, a connection shaft, a tongue body special-shaped block, a tongue root special-shaped block, a tongue and telescopic connection rod connection shaft, a telescopic stepped shaft, a coupler, an upper plate, a driving gear, a swing motor, a driven motor, a gear shaft, a lower plate, a telescopic motor, a screw nut, a screw, a telescopic supporting shaft, a curling motor and a telescopic connection rod. The tongue movement mechanism is rarely found in a conventional head robot and improves the human-imitativeness of the head robot further. Telescoping control of a tongue is achieved according to the diamond instability, and the method is simple and reliable. The curling part of the tongue is far from the motors. According to the invention, steel wires are adopted for driving, and the difficulty of remote driving is overcome.

Description

Technical field [0001] The invention relates to a tongue movement mechanism of a human-like head robot, which belongs to the technical field of robots. Background technique [0002] The tongue movement of the humanoid head robot is inseparable from the anthropomorphism of the robot. The tongue plays a very key auxiliary role in the expression of various exaggerated expressions of the humanoid robot and the chewing movement of the mouth. The study is close to the human tongue movement The human-like tongue mechanism has always been an important topic in the field of robotics. But so far, most of the mouth mechanisms of human-like head robots only realize the movement of the upper and lower jaws, and rarely involve the design of the tongue mechanism. Therefore, it is very important to study the tongue movement mechanism of human-like function.
